Associate Director, Office of Vocations

Father Drew is originally from St. Louis Catholic Church in Castroville, Texas, part of the Archdiocese of San Antonio. He attended the University of Notre Dame and studied Economics and Political Science while living in Fisher Hall. Instead of pursuing law school as he had planned, he taught as an ACE Teaching Fellow in the Alliance for Catholic Education (ACE). There, he fell in love with Catholic education and, after graduating from ACE in 2011, he worked as the Associate Director of Notre Dame’s Institute for Educational Initiatives for several years before discerning God’s call to enter Holy Cross. Ordained a Holy Cross Priest in 2022, Father Drew spent his deacon year and first year of priesthood as a middle school teacher and administrator at St. Adalbert School (South Bend, Indiana). He also served as Associate Pastor to the St. Adalbert and St. Casimir Parishes.
